x
Loading...

I-295 in Delaware Northbound

Searching: Electronics Clear

Exit
New Castle, DE
Ham Radio Outlet
Right (W) - 0.8 miles
1509 N Dupont Hwy, New Castle, DE 19720
7
Reviews